Documentation
¶
Index ¶
- Constants
- func ClusterEndpointFromDrainerConfig(drainerConfig v1alpha1.DrainerConfig) string
- func ClusterIDFromDrainerConfig(drainerConfig v1alpha1.DrainerConfig) string
- func IsCriticalPod(podName string) bool
- func IsDaemonSetPod(pod v1.Pod) bool
- func IsDeploymentPod(podName string) bool
- func IsEvictedPod(pod v1.Pod) bool
- func IsWrongTypeError(err error) bool
- func NodeNameFromDrainerConfig(drainerConfig v1alpha1.DrainerConfig) string
- func ToDrainerConfig(v interface{}) (v1alpha1.DrainerConfig, error)
Constants ¶
View Source
const (
LabelNodeOperatorVersion = "node-operator.giantswarm.io/version"
)
Variables ¶
This section is empty.
Functions ¶
func ClusterEndpointFromDrainerConfig ¶
func ClusterEndpointFromDrainerConfig(drainerConfig v1alpha1.DrainerConfig) string
func ClusterIDFromDrainerConfig ¶
func ClusterIDFromDrainerConfig(drainerConfig v1alpha1.DrainerConfig) string
func IsCriticalPod ¶
func IsDaemonSetPod ¶
func IsDeploymentPod ¶ added in v1.4.2
func IsEvictedPod ¶
func IsWrongTypeError ¶
IsWrongTypeError asserts wrongTypeError.
func NodeNameFromDrainerConfig ¶
func NodeNameFromDrainerConfig(drainerConfig v1alpha1.DrainerConfig) string
func ToDrainerConfig ¶
func ToDrainerConfig(v interface{}) (v1alpha1.DrainerConfig, error)
Types ¶
This section is empty.
Click to show internal directories.
Click to hide internal directories.